What is the meaning of the name Emric ?

The baby name Emric is a boy name 2 syllables long and is pronounced EM-rick.

Emric is Germanic in Origin.

Emric is a unique and uncommon name that has its roots in Germanic languages. The name Emric is derived from the Germanic name Amalric, which means "work-ruler" or "ruler of work." The name was popularized in the Middle Ages and was borne by several notable figures, including Amalric I, King of Jerusalem. The name Emric is a combination of two Germanic words, "amal" meaning work and "ric" meaning ruler.
